Thank you very much. Front is 2.5 spindles along with 2 inch lowering springs, rear is 4 inch lowering springs and 2 inch lowering blocks, adjustable pan hard bar. Shocks are from Classic Performance.

Here's my 68, it is what I assume to be a 4/6 static drop with 28-inch 235/75-15 tires on it. I bought it like this and have no details other than it has 2' drop spindles on the front. I am seriously considering going up to a 2/4 drop because the mean streets of Houston make this thing ride like HELL! The angles of the shocks and the drop make the shocks almost useless. Anyone know of any drop shocks that actually work well-enough for me to keep my drop? I hope the picture attaches, no gurantees.

IMO - dropped spindles wouldn't make it ride rough, but if the rear shocks are in the factory location it definitely would. ECE offers shock relocation brackets for the rear that could probably help a bunch.

I finally did some research and realized that the stock rear shock locations are useless with a 6" drop. I will be taking care of that soon. So this relates to the thread: If you drop the rear, relocate the shock mounts making sure that the shocks fit the application. An adjustable track bar is nice to have too.
